Message From Principal, Campus Two and Three Dear Parents and Students, It is a great pleasure to write this message as the Principal of Australian International School, Dhaka's Campus Two and Three. I have over thirty years of experience as a school administrator in Canada and China. I believe learning is a life long experience and students need to develop the skills and understandings needed to realize their potential. This is accomplished through the Australian curriculum. The curriculum is hands-on, activity based curriculum with expected outcomes and it stresses critical, as well as, creative thinking skills. We want our students to ask questions and take a risk as they prepare for the external assessment requirements of The Western Australian Certificate of Education in Year 12. This certificate will allow students to apply to universities around the world. I am very eager to work with my staff of well qualified and experienced teachers and with you, the parents.
